Studying color theory and its interior applications
Color theory is fundamental to prosperous Interior Design, dictating mood and perceived space. Professionals meticulously apply color principles to transform an ordinary apartment or expansive house into a cohesive environment. For instance, cool tones can expand a small kitchen, while warm hues foster intimacy in a living area. The strategic application of color in Interior Design even extends to specialized settings, like healthcare facilities, where calming palettes are vital for patient well-being, or a vibrant garden villa design.
Understanding how colors interact with light and other elements is essential for any Interior Design project. The selection impacts everything from the perceived dimensions of a room to its overall energy. A skilled Interior Design practitioner knows that color is not merely decorative; it is a powerful tool to evoke emotion and enhance functionality within any art space, whether a compact city dwelling or a sprawling luxury interior design villa.
How lighting molds the ambiance of interiors
lighting is a basic component of successful interior design, profoundly influencing the mood and utility of any space. Thoughtful lighting transforms environments, enhancing both visual attractiveness and practical utility. Professionals of interior design learn the strategic placement of various light sources to form perceptions of spaciousness, warmth, and intimacy within an area, creating distinct interior atmospheres.
Understanding the interaction between light and existing color schemes is crucial for sophisticated interior design. lighting dramatically alters how colors appear, subtly shifting their perceived saturation and hue. Expertise in color theory applies to selecting suitable lighting temperatures and intensities, ensuring that the chosen aesthetic for interior design is consistently shown. Successful lighting contributes significantly to effective decorating interiors, blending seamlessly with other interior design concepts like textiles and decorative arts to offer consistent interior design solutions.

textiles and soft furnishings within interior design
Textiles and soft furnishings are key elements in creating comfortable and aesthetically appealing interior design. They introduce texture, pattern, and color, profoundly influencing the overall feel of an interior design project. Thoughtful selection enhances the functionality and visual appeal of any residential interior design or commercial interior design space. In the realm of interior design, textiles are fundamental for layering and depth.
From luxurious drapes and custom cushions to area rugs and upholstery on a carefully chosen sofa, textiles determine spatial zones and soften architectural lines. The interplay of different fabrics, such as velvet, linen, or silk, helps to the tactile experience of an interior design. These elements complement furniture design, tying diverse pieces into a consistent interior design scheme. Professionals in interior styling comprehend how textiles can dramatically transform a room's atmosphere, making it feel more inviting or formal. Many interior designers and interior decorators employ textiles to inject personality and reflect the homeowner's style, creating bespoke interior spaces.
